Shankly Bearing Separator (75-105mm or 2.95' - 4.13' inches), Large Bearing Splitter Review:


The day it arrived, I used it. helped me remove a bearing from a pinion shaft (dimensions: 43X90X30) without destroying the roller cage. There may be a 2mm gap between the pinion and the bearing, which is a fairly tight tolerance. Without damaging the cage, I was unable to remove my old divider. If the bearing is just being replaced, it is irrelevant if it was destroyed. However, a decent instrument like this is important when the only option is to reuse a reliable bearing. If the cage continues to spin while you press out the separator, you're good. If not, I would still advise you to readjust numerous times during removal. Lisle 34550 Handy Packer Bearing Packer Review:


I'd purchase it once more.This is a reliable machine that can accommodate bearings in a variety of widths and thicknesses. I advise performing a thorough first cleaning of the bearing using kerosene or something comparable as a final rinse, then letting it air dry. This will get rid of the dirty grease that eventually gets into the fresh, new grease in the packer's base or cup.I saw a reference to using a vice, but since the packer is made of plastic, if too much pressure is applied it could break without warning, so I would not try that. The process of squeezing the new grease into the bearing was easy, but a bit slow (and during summer temps), but was helped by placing a 25# bag of #6 lead shot on the top for added force.In less than 15 minutes (not counting the initial cleaning) using this technique, 4 front bearings were repacked, using only a few ounces of grease. The remaining grease was then simply stored by placing the packer's lid on it, making it ready for use without having to be refilled.OMT: You might want to purchase at least that much grease because this base can contain a full 16 ounces of it.

Shankly Two Jaws Harmonic Bearing Puller and Gear Pulley Puller Review:


JAW END DIMENSIONS: around 0.350" thick and 0.880" wide.Note: If you pull the threaded screw's conical centering piece, it will come out. An o-friction ring's keeps it in place.An harmonic balancer from a Volvo 940 was easily removed with this puller (crank pulley). Because the tool is small enough and the jaw ends fit through the pulley slots, you can use it without removing the radiator fan or radiator.1) Thread the crank bolt in again, but without the washer. Thread it in barely halfway.2) Remove the jaw arms from the crosspiece and secure them with hooks directed toward the center of the crank pulley. To hold the hooks in place, the jaw arms will flare outward.3) Remove the conical centering piece from the lead screw of the puller, then thread the screw in until only about 1" of travel is left.4) Connect the puller crosspiece to the jaw arms of the puller.5) If the crank bolt does not make contact with the puller lead screw end, loosen it a little.6) Hold on to the puller arms to prevent the pulley from spinning as you turn the puller screw with a box wrench.Et voilà.

Yoohe Aluminum Suction Cup Dent PullerHandle Lifter – Dent Remover Heavy Duty Glass Lifting – Ball Joint Service Tool Kit and Tie Rod Tools Review:


Before purchasing, take sure to properly inspect your dent if you plan to use this as a dent-puller. Verify the size, texture, depth, and shape of your dent. As long as your situation meets the conditions I mention, it's a very good tool. Its construction is solid, and the suction mechanism works easily and well. It has a 4.75" diameter suction pad on it, which means you need at least 5 inches of flat and smooth surface area (in all directions) for it to grab. If your dent doesn't have this, it won't work. I have to imagine this is the cause of most (or all) of the one-star reviews on here,
